Explain how President Obama used technology as part of his campaign strategy during the 2008 presidential election

History
1 answer:
puteri [66]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

They used analytics, social media and big data.

Explanation:

During the elections in 2008, Obama understood the importance and impact that the internet and technology can have on the results and they used social media to reach as many people as they can, informing them and trying to get their votes. They also used analytics science and big data to understand people's behaviours and needs, enabling them to direct their advertisements and movements online and on social media according to that.

Who is the father of modern physics
tankabanditka [31]

Answer:

Galileo Galilei

Explanation:

Galileo Galilei pioneered the experimental scientific method, and was the first to use a refracting telescope to make important astronomical discoveries. He is often referred to as the "father of modern astronomy" and the "father of modern physics". Albert Einstein called Galileo the "father of modern science."
